Sacha’s “Detox” Salad
Here is a yummy salad recipe to have for lunch or dinner. It tastes delicious, is easy to make, and like all salads can be modified as you like it. Please choose organic ingredients.
What you need:
Leafy salad greens like arugula, baby kale, spinach
Red cabbage - finely shredded
Celery: finely chopped
Beetroot - peeled and grated (blanched first if you don't like it raw or too "earthy")
Apple - thinly sliced or grated (peeled if it's not organic)
Orange - peeled/chopped/sliced
Chia &/or Hemp &/or Sesame Seeds
Avocado
Fresh squeezed lime (or lemon) juice
Sea Salt
Extra Virgin Olive Oil
Olives & Sun-dried tomatoes (optional) -
How to:
In your very favorite salad bowl, toss together the greens and the cabbage.
Then toss in the celery, beets, apple and orange.
Squeeze fresh lime (or lemon) juice over the salad.
Pour a generous glug of olive oil.
Toss in the olives and sun dried tomatoesAdd the chia/hemp/sesame seeds.
Sprinkle a little pink Himalayan or sea salt.
Toss very well. Leave to sit for 10-15 minutes so the flavors meld.
Serve into individual bowls
Add some slices of avocado onto individual serving bowls (about 1/4 avocado per person).
